Definitions
Noun
- 1 The branch of medicine which deals with the prevention and correction of deformities in bodies; orthopedics. uncountable
Etymology
From ortho- + -pedia. From Ancient Greek ὀρθός (orthós, “correction”) combined with παῖς (paîs, “child”). See also orthopedic.
